Unique Plants

When it comes to gardening gifts, unique plants can be a delightful and thoughtful choice for the green-thumbed enthusiast in your life. Whether they are looking to add a pop of color, expand their collection, or try something new, there are plenty of interesting plant varieties that make perfect gifts.

Exotic Flowering Plants

For the gardener who loves exotic blooms, consider gifting them with unique flowering plants such as orchids, proteas, or bird of paradise. These striking and unusual flowers will add a touch of drama and elegance to any garden and will be sure to impress any gardening aficionado.

Rare Succulents and Cacti

Succulents and cacti are incredibly popular among gardeners for their low-maintenance nature and interesting shapes. Consider surprising your gardening friend with rare or unusual succulent varieties like lithops, Echeveria ‘Black Prince’, or variegated agave. These unique plants will make a stunning addition to their collection.

Unusual Fruit Trees

For the gardener with a bit more space, consider gifting them with an unusual fruit tree variety such as dwarf pawpaw, quince, or goji berry. Not only will these fruit trees provide delicious home-grown produce, but they will also add an element of novelty and interest to the garden.

DIY Kits

Looking for unique and creative ideas for gardening gifts? DIY kits are a fantastic option for garden enthusiasts who enjoy getting their hands dirty and creating something beautiful. Whether they have a green thumb or are just starting out, these DIY kits offer a fun and educational experience that can be enjoyed by all.

Here are some DIY kit ideas that make perfect gifts for the gardening enthusiast in your life:

  • Herb Garden Kit: Give the gift of fresh herbs with a complete herb garden kit. These kits typically include everything needed to start growing herbs indoors or outdoors, such as pots, soil, seeds, and instructions for care. It’s a great way to add flavor to their cooking while adding a touch of greenery to their home.
  • Terrarium Kit: For those who enjoy bringing the outdoors inside, a terrarium kit is an excellent choice. These kits come with everything needed to create a mini indoor garden, including glass containers, soil, rocks, and miniature plants. They make for unique and eye-catching decorative pieces that are sure to be appreciated.
  • Flower Arrangement Kit: If your gardener loves to bring beautiful blooms indoors, consider giving them a flower arrangement kit. These kits typically include a selection of fresh flowers along with vase options and instructions on how to create stunning floral displays. It’s a thoughtful gift that allows them to showcase their gardening skills in their home.
